    Mozingo

    See everyone talking about the lake and see some good catches from the lake as well. Living down by Wichita it is a bit far but I do have a friend by KC and we are looking for a place to go. Is the lake full of grass, timber? It looks like a fun lake with some really nice fish. What is the general layout of the lake. Thanks Greg

    Re: Mozingo (GClark519)

    grass, standing timber in the creek arms and upper end, main lake brush piles, road beds, fence rows, and a couple ledges is the primary structure...

    google maps - Mozingo Lake, Polk Mo for a decent look at the lake


    oh yea almost forgot the old farm ponds...
